Summary of the L1 Visa

Types of L1 Visas

Numerous sorts of L1 visas deal with the diverse demands of international firms looking to transfer employees to the USA. The two primary classifications of L1 visas are L1A and L1B, each made for details roles and duties within an organization. L1 Visa.The L1A visa is intended for supervisors and execs. This classification permits business to transfer individuals that hold supervisory or executive settings, enabling them to look after operations in the U.S. This visa is legitimate for a preliminary period of as much as three years, with the possibility of extensions for a total of up to 7 years. The L1A visa is specifically useful for business looking for to establish a strong leadership existence in the U.S. market.On the various other hand, the L1B visa is designated for staff members with specialized expertise. This consists of people who have sophisticated know-how in particular areas, such as proprietary technologies or unique processes within the firm. The L1B visa is additionally legitimate for a first three-year duration, with extensions available for up to 5 years. This visa classification is suitable for firms that need employees with specialized abilities to enhance their operations and preserve an one-upmanship in the U.S.Both L1A and L1B visas enable twin intent, suggesting that visa holders can apply for long-term residency while on the visa. Comprehending the differences in between these two groups is crucial for businesses preparing to navigate the intricacies of employee transfers to the United States efficiently
Qualification Requirements
To qualify for an L1 visa, both the employer and the employee must meet particular qualification criteria set by united state immigration authorities. The L1 visa is developed for intra-company transferees, allowing international business to transfer workers to their united state offices.First, the company should be a qualifying organization, which suggests it has to have a moms and dad firm, branch, subsidiary, or associate that is operating both in the united state and in the foreign nation. This relationship is vital for showing that the employee is being moved within the same company structure. The employer must likewise have been doing business for at least one year in both locations.Second, the worker must have been used by the foreign company for a minimum of one continuous year within the 3 years coming before the application. This employment has to remain in a supervisory, executive, or specialized knowledge capacity. For L1A visas, which provide to managers and execs, the worker must demonstrate that they will certainly proceed to operate in a comparable ability in the united state For L1B visas, meant for employees with specialized understanding, the specific have to possess special know-how that contributes substantially to the business's procedures.
Application Process
Navigating the application process for an L1 visa includes numerous vital steps that have to be finished accurately to ensure an effective end result. The very first step is to establish the proper category of the L1 visa: L1A for managers and execs, or L1B for workers with specialized expertise. This distinction is substantial, as it impacts the documents required.Once the category is identified, the U.S. company must submit Type I-129, Application for a Nonimmigrant Worker. This type must consist of thorough info about the company, the staff member's role, and the nature of the work to be carried out in the U.S. Accompanying paperwork usually consists of evidence of the connection in between the united state and foreign entities, evidence of the worker's credentials, and details pertaining to the job offer.After entry, the U.S. Citizenship and Migration Services (USCIS) will review the application. If accepted, the staff member will certainly be alerted, and they can after that request the visa at an U.S. consulate or consular office in their home nation. This involves completing Type DS-160, the Online Nonimmigrant copyright, and scheduling an interview.During the interview, the applicant must present different documents, including the approved Form I-129, proof of employment, and any kind of extra supporting evidence. Following the meeting, if the visa is provided, the staff member will certainly get a visa stamp in their copyright, permitting them to enter the U.S. to benefit learn more the sponsoring company. Appropriate preparation and extensive paperwork are vital to steering this procedure properly.
Benefits of the L1 Visa
Among the remarkable advantages of the L1 visa is its capacity to promote the transfer of essential employees from worldwide offices to the USA. This visa is particularly advantageous for international business looking for to maintain uniformity in procedures and management across boundaries. By enabling executives, supervisors, and specialized staff members to work in the U.S., companies can assure that their most crucial talent is offered to drive service objectives.Another significant benefit of the L1 visa is its relatively uncomplicated application procedure compared to various other work visas. Organizations can petition for the L1 visa without the requirement for a labor qualification, which enhances the employment of foreign staff members. Moreover, the visa can be approved for an initial duration of approximately 3 years, with the possibility of extensions, promoting long-lasting assignments.The L1 visa also provides a path to long-term residency. Staff members on L1A visas (for supervisors and executives) can make an application for a Permit after one year, expediting their change to permanent status. This attribute is an eye-catching motivation for skilled individuals searching for stability in the united state workforce.Additionally, L1 visa holders can bring their immediate relative to the U.S. under L2 standing, permitting partners and kids to reside and study in the country, enhancing the total allure of this visa classification. Generally, the L1 visa functions as a crucial tool for worldwide businesses, fostering cross-border partnership and talent wheelchair.
Usual Obstacles
While the L1 visa offers numerous benefits for multinational companies and their workers, it is not without its challenges. One significant hurdle is the rigorous documents and eligibility requirements enforced by the U.S. Citizenship and Migration Services (USCIS) Business have to give comprehensive proof of the foreign staff member's certifications, the nature of the organization, and the certifying partnership between the united state and international entities. This process can be time-consuming and might require lawful knowledge to navigate successfully.Another obstacle is the possibility for scrutiny throughout the petition process. USCIS police officers might examine the legitimacy of the company operations or the staff member's duty within the company. This scrutiny can bring about hold-ups or even denials of the copyright, which can substantially affect the business's functional strategies and the worker's profession trajectory.Furthermore, the L1 visa is linked to the funding company, which suggests that task adjustments can complicate the visa standing. If an L1 visa holder wants to switch companies, they must usually seek a various visa group, which can add intricacy to their migration journey.Lastly, maintaining conformity with L1 visa policies is vital. Companies should assure that their staff member's function aligns with the initial request which the company proceeds to satisfy the qualification demands. Failure to do so can cause retraction of the visa, affecting both the staff member and the company. These challenges require comprehensive prep work and ongoing monitoring to ensure a successful L1 visa experience.

Can Household Members Accompany L1 Visa Holders?
Yes, relative can come with L1 visa holders. Partners and single kids under 21 years of ages are eligible for L2 visas, which permit them to live and study in the USA throughout the L1 owner's remain.
How Much Time Can L1 Visa Holders Keep in the united state?
L1 visa owners can originally stay in the united state for as much as three years (L1 Visa). This period might be prolonged, allowing a maximum keep of 7 years for L1A visa owners and five years for L1B visa owners
